CPT code 96372 covers two routes only: Subcutaneous (SC) : Injection into the subcutaneous tissue layer beneath the skin, used for agents such as insulin, low-molecular-weight heparins, and some biologics Intramuscular (IM) : Injection into the muscle, used for antibiotics, anti-inflammatories, hormonal agents, and vaccines when billed under the therapeutic injection pathway Intravenous (IV) push, intra-arterial, and infusion routes are not covered by procedure code 96372 and require separate codes
